ALEXANDR DUGIN, top Russian philosopher, on the war in Ukraine: "... This is not a war with Ukraine. It's a comparison with globalism as a whole planetary phenomenon. It’s a comparison on all levels - geopolitical and ideological. Russia rejects everything in globalism - unipolarism, atlantism, on the one hand, and liberalism, anti-tradition, technocracy, Grand Reset in one word, on the other. It is clear that all European leaders are part of the Atlantic liberal elite.

And we’re at war with this exactly. Here's their legitimate reaction. Russia is now excluded from the globalist networks. She has no choice anymore: either build her own world or disappear. Russia has set a path to building its world, its civilization. And now the first step has been done. But sovereign in the face of globalism can only be a large space, a continent-state, a civilization-state. No country can withstand long a complete disconnect.

Russia is building a global resistance camp. His victory would be a victory for all the alternative forces, both the right and the left, and for all the people. As always, we are starting the most difficult and dangerous processes.

But when we win, everybody takes advantage of it. That's how it should be. We are creating the assumptions for a real multipolarity. And those who are ready to kill us now will be the first to take advantage of our business tomorrow. I almost always write things that come true. This too will come true".............
